Python SQLite是一个轻量级的嵌入式数据库,它提供了一个简单的方式来存储和管理数据。SQLite数据库是一个零配置的数据库,不需要单独的服务器进程或配置,可以直接在应用程序中使用。
SQLite数据库的主要特点包括:
- 轻量级:SQLite数据库非常小巧,数据库文件可以轻松地嵌入到应用程序中,不需要额外的安装和配置。
- 零配置:SQLite数据库不需要单独的服务器进程,也不需要复杂的配置,可以直接在应用程序中使用。
- 单用户:SQLite数据库是单用户的,只能由一个进程访问,这可以简化并发控制和数据一致性的问题。
- 支持标准SQL:SQLite数据库支持标准的SQL语法,可以使用SQL语句进行数据的查询、插入、更新和删除操作。
- 事务支持:SQLite数据库支持事务,可以保证数据的一致性和完整性。
- 跨平台:SQLite数据库可以在多个操作系统上运行,包括Windows、Linux和Mac OS等。
Python SQLite可以用于各种应用场景,包括:
- 嵌入式应用:由于SQLite数据库的轻量级和零配置特性,它非常适合用于嵌入式应用中,如移动应用、物联网设备等。
- 小型应用:对于一些小型的应用程序,SQLite数据库可以作为一个简单而有效的数据存储解决方案。
- 原型开发:在原型开发阶段,使用SQLite数据库可以快速地建立一个简单的数据存储和管理系统。
腾讯云提供了云数据库SQL Server版和云数据库MySQL版等产品,可以满足不同的数据库需求。您可以访问腾讯云官网了解更多关于云数据库的信息:腾讯云数据库。